Специалист | Adobe Flash CS5CS4. Уровень 3. ActionScript 3.0 [2011] PCRec
Автор (режиссер): Специалист
Название: Adobe Flash CS5CS4. Уровень 3. ActionScript 3.0
Год выпуска: 2011
Жанр: Программирование
Язык: Русский
Качество видео: PCRec
Продолжительность: 20:59:01
Видеокодек: G2M4
Битрейт видео: ~250 Kbps
Размер кадра: 1280 x 1024 и 1200 x 900
Аудиокодек: WMA
Битрейт аудио: 48.0 Kbps
Описание:С помощью объектно-ориентированного языка программирования ActionScript 3 можно создавать различные flash-приложения, такие как flash-баннеры, flash-игры и даже целые сайты, с которыми Вы наверняка сталкивались в интернете. На этом курсе Вы научитесь модифицировать код, написанный на языке ActionScript 2.0, под ActionScript 3.0., работать с геометрическими объектами, работать с XML, освоите программную анимацию и многое другое.
Цель курса:
Научиться создавать сложные Flash-проекты, используя объектно-ориентированные подходы программирования.
По окончании курса Вы будете уметь:
Использовать приемы объектно-ориентированного программирования в ActionScript 3.0
Динамически рисовать векторные фигуры и управлять ими
Загружать данные из внешних XML-файлов
Настраивать параметры встроенных Flash-компонентов и управлять внешним видом компонентов
Создавать формы для отправки данных на Web-сервер
В раздаче также присутствуют: файлы примеров и дополнительная документация по AS 3.0 Модуль 1. Введение в объектно-ориентированное программирование на ActionScript 3.0.
Преимущества Action Script 3.0
Среды разработки и среды выполнения Flash. Компиляция
ActionScript 3.0, как объектно-ориентированный язык программирования
Обзор основных предопределённых классов и объектов
Создание программы. Пакеты и их структура
Создание пользовательских классов. Конструктор класса
Идентификаторы доступа Private, Public, Protected, Internal
Типы данных
Область видимости и пространства имен
Как модифицировать код, написанный на языке ActionScript 2.0, под ActionScript 3.0.
Модуль 2. Интерактивность
«Слушатели» событий
Создание обработчиков событий мыши и клавиатуры
Диспетчеризация события
Получение информации о событии и объекте вызвавшем событие
Модуль 3. Программная анимация
Событие Event.ENTER_FRAME
Использование экземпляра класса Timer
Динамическое присоединение экземпляров из библиотеки ролика
Загрузка внешних данных – методы urlLoader и urlRequest
Модуль 4. Список отображения
Обзор модели отображения и её отличие от АС2.0
Добавление объектов в список отображения
Удаление объектов из списка отображения
Перебор всех объектов в списке отображения
Модуль 5. Динамическое рисование
Задание стиля линии
Задание стиля заливки
Рисование прямой и кривой линии
Рисование простых геометрических фигур
Создание масок
Модуль 6. Загрузка файлов
Загрузка данных при помощи класса flash.display.Loader
Использование сторонних библиотек классов
Класс BulkLoader
Модуль 7. Использование сторонних библиотек классов
Класс BulkLoader
Класс Tweener
Модуль 8. Массивы
Массивы с целочисленными индексами
Ассоциативные массивы
Методы массивов
Модуль 9. Работа с растровыми изображениями
Классы BitMap и BitMapData
Создание «принтскрина» мувиклипа и всей рабочей области
Создание эффектов с растровыми изображениями
Модуль 10. Работа с текстом и текстовыми полями
Динамическое создание текстовых полей
Форматирование текстовых полей
Работа с тестом
Модуль 11. Работа с XML
Введение в XML. Расширение E4X
Создание XML-данных роликом
Загрузка внешних XML данных
Анализ и обработка XML данных
Преобразование объектов XML в строки
Работа со строковыми данными и регулярными выражениями
Модуль 12. Объектно-ориентированное программирование (ООП)
Основы ООП
Передача данных в конструктор класса
Super();
Get- и Set- методы
Замена наследуемого метода
Статические методы и свойства
Динамические классы
Интерфейсы
Паттерны ООП
Модуль 13. Клиент-серверное взаимодействие
Загрузка текстовых файлов
Получение данных с сервера
Отправка данных на сервер
Модуль 14. Работа с компонентами
Обзор встроенных flash-компонентов
Работа с Видео
Скриншоты: Время раздачи: Ближе к вечеру и до утра.
Специалист | Adobe Flash CS5CS4. Уровень 1. Основы веб - анимации [2010] PCRecСпециалист | Adobe Flash CS5/CS4. Уровень 2. Классическая анимация и создание баннеров [2011] PCRecСпециалист | Adobe Flash CS5/CS4. Уровень 2. Интерактивная анимация и программирование на ActionScript 2.0 [2011] PCRec